41.02Involuntary Dismissal; Effect Thereof (a) The court may upon its own initiative, or upon motion of a party, and upon such notice as it may prescribe, dismiss an action or claim for failure to prosecute or to comply with these rules or any order of the court.

The Domestic Abuse Act allows victims of domestic abuse to petition for an order for protection against the alleged abuser. Violation of the order can result in jail or prison time. In Minnesota, victims of domestic abuse can go to civil court to petition (request) an order for protection (OFP).

If you wish to change, extend, or cancel your order, you can file a Petition/Motion to Dismiss, Extend, or Modify Other Conditions of Order Of Protection. The court will set a date for a hearing and the abuser will be served with a copy of the motion and a request to be present.

Rule 520(a) establishes a 20-day time period for obtaining an order to vacate a default judgment order or order for judgment of dismissal. The 20 days is measured from the mailing of the notice of judgment, and the law requires that an additional three days be added to the time period when notice is served by mail.

Order for Protection (OFP): An OFP is issued by a judge in court (separate from divorce hearings) and is brought by an individual seeking protection from domestic abuse by a family or household member. There is no fee for an OFP and individuals do not need to be represented by an attorney to request an OFP.
